About 2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ine
2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ine (PubChem CID 129380989) has the molecular formula C12H20N4O
and a molecular weight of 236.32 g/mol. Its IUPAC name is 2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ine.

What is the SMILES notation for 2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ine?
The canonical SMILES for 2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ine is CNc1cc(N[C@@H](C)COC)nc(C2CC2)n1.
What is the InChIKey of 2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ine?
The InChIKey is XQGLRBPRZTZVSM-QMMMGPOBSA-N. The full InChI is InChI=1S/C12H20N4O/c1-8(7-17-3)14-11-6-10(13-2)15-12(16-11)9-4-5-9/h6,8-9H,4-5,7H2,1-3H3,(H2,13,14,15,16)/t8-/m0/s1.
What are the key properties of 2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ine?
2-cyclopropyl-4-N-[(2S)-1-methoxypropan-2-yl]-6-N-methylpyrimidine-4,6-diamine has a molecular weight of 236.32 g/mol, XLogP of 1.84, 6 rotatable bonds, 2 hydrogen bond donors, and 5 hydrogen bond acceptors.
